Just wanted to let everyone know that Toronto booker extraordinaire Yvonne Matsell, formerly of the late great Ted's Wrecking Yard, has landed at the horrid little dive on College Street known as Rancho Relaxo. ;) Glad to hear that she'll be working her booking magic *some*where, but I have to say I'm not a big fan of the very seedy Rancho and its cramped upstairs space. Oh, well - I suppose it is about the music and not the atmosphere, right? ;) Although it's always nice when the two intersect. :) And besides, most of the list favourites, including Emm and Sarah, have moved on up from a space like Ted's, let alone *Rancho Relaxo* (!), but it'll be good for some of their other compadres like Leslie Feist, Jason Collett, et al. And speaking of Mr. Collett, Yvonne's reign at Rancho gets underway this coming Monday night with the relaunch of the excellent old "Radio Mondays" songwriters' series, hosted by Jason Collett. The January/February lineup is as follows (with the first two looking especially promising): Jan 7: Spookey Ruben, Leslie Feist, Jim Guthrie, Metric Jan 14: Kate Fenner, Chris Brown, Aaron Riches (Royal City), Andrew Cash (Cash Brothers) Jan 21: Moe Berg, Ian Lefeuvre (Starling), Lynn Miles, Kat Goldman Jan 28: Ian Blurton (Blurtonia), Howie Beck, Andrew Rodriguez (Bodega), Ruby Drake Feb 4: John Critchley (13 Engines), Dave Clark (Woodchoppers Association), Josh Finlayson (Skydiggers), Amy Millan (Stars) Feb 11: Luther Wright (Weeping Tile, Luther Wright & The Wrongs), Jenny Whiteley (Heartbreak Hill), Bob Egan (Blue Rodeo, Wilco), Reid Jameson So yeah, normally I prefer to avoid dives like Rancho Relaxo like the plague, but when the music's this good and interesting (potentially, anyway - - I've been to a lot of Radio Mondays and they're almost always terrific), hopefully it'll transcend the atmosphere...
